Season 10, Episode 3: "Riley" Report
General Summary
In the middle of Mist's update about the reality of Paradise, Riley revealed that she was in fact the grandmother of Bast — and the entire table broke into a clamoring for answers. Once the room could settle, Riley gladly summarized the story told by the Codex of Whispers as she had seen it, including the pieces that Valka never finished. Of Sara's disdain of Bast, and Chang Lu's protectiveness, and Foly's desire for peace. All of which came to a head in the battle Mist saw in Paradise, where Sara and Bast went head-to-head to determine the true owner of Azkhrumdar.
Their duel and the battle ended at the same moment, as Bast was forced to touch upon his patron Crow to survive, and an infection spread through the boy and the ax, and through it the weapon's connection to the World Tree at the metaphysical center of Norn. Countless died, and Valka was horifically maimed — the very sight of which caused Bast to flee up the mountain seen in All Is Lost, leading to the creation of the Entwined Infinities. The Petal had been frozen ever since, trapped in a mystical winter where time flowed but nothing seemed to change...
When asked about the Hoppers that had come from Norn to the Infinity Petal, this prompted a larger lecture about the current conflict, and all of the various players in that game. Lockette was careful to record the audio for future use (see Who's Who in Whoville?), and the group was astonished to learn the depth of the war they had waded into — now coming to a head at the Boneyard.
While Gonjo wished to touch on that specifically, they were interrupted by the arrival of Zeylan Trinipol, who claimed that something was awry on the docks. Then a quake pounded through Ezorod, and the conference room split to protect their various interests, with the Dream Team going to handle the threat.
They found a commandeered merchant ship pouring out Wither Wraiths and Doom Heralds — the latter of which began to coat the Mercenary's blades with their essence as he defeated them. Although deadly to the citizens, they themselves did not present an immediate danger to the crew, until one of the Wraiths revealed its true form, and the Centurion drove his spear into MaMa's side. Slicing Wither into her veins, sending her deep into the second stage of the corruption, the group leapt into defensive manuevers — just as Niko entered through Ezorod's portal with Atalanta and their son, and Tesin Movahesh and Skittles came to their aid.
As the citizens made their retreat into the bubble city's depths, the party grew bolder in their attack patterns, with MaMa eventually resorting to summoning the Wild Hunt. This gave the Centurion pause, causing to him fleeing back out into the sun, although the Erlking and his knights never answered the call of Tesin's horn...
Worried that they were missing the attack's true intention, but unable to determine their secondary objective after a sweep of the station, the group reconvened for a quick talk. Niko, having been invited by Cromwell to Montressor, accepted MaMa's offer to train up the station security — especially those who had grown lazy under the umbrella of Qwerty's genius. Although Mu Draconis had her own troubles with the man, she was content at Cromwell's suggestion to let him live for now, and serve as best as he could until the arrival of End Day.
Then the conference resumed, with Lockette largely leading the meeting with a list of questions. Gonjo and Riley answered to the best of their ability, aiming to be helpful, and snatched moments to flesh out the beginnings of their assault of the Boneyard — which they feared would be concluded one way or another in the next three days. But Gonjo promised them aid, showing them a vision of their allies, which included Rastelviri, Ceres, Gillby and his tribes, the Children of the Forge, and (conditionally) Mandarb and Caesura — among the other Deaths who had chosen not to follow Charon. He promised others as well, but claimed that he would need time to confirm their allegiance... And then Lockette's phone rang, with a call from friend.
Crow's voice boomed on the other end:
Crow: "Say goodbye to Dr. Lebowitz."
Then the call ended.
